It *can* have an impact, yes, but in practice it's almost never going to
happen.  You'd need to have the affected players tied on points at the
right moment (uncommon) AND have the exact same head-to-head record, and
have at least one of the affected players have a forfeit that materially
changed their ladder ranking (a forfeit that doesn't change the ladder
outcome is effectively ignored, and a week-forfeit that keeps the player
in-group is at most a single ladder point).

> Div Avg Ladder is your average ladder position at the end of Weeks 3-8,
> the first two and the last two are omitted from this calculation.  Ladder
> corresponds to your groupings, not how many points you earned.
>
>
>
> The first two weeks are omitted so that if we misplaced anyone in a group,
> they have a chance to bubble up or down to where they're supposed to be.
> The last two weeks are omitted because divisions are locked in at that
> point and no one is able to shift divisions after week 8.
>
>
>
> The first tiebreaker is always head to head standings.  If there is a tie
> for head to head (or if the two players in question never played each
> other,) then the next tiebreaker is the division average ladder.  If for
> some reason that is tied, then we go to your ladder position at the end of
> week 10, with the higher ranked player prevailing.
